I have an 88 Cutlass Supreme. The service engine light has been going off and on, I dont know if that is something to do with the problem. All of a sudden, car would start up and then die. After a few times of dying, it would idle but then seem to have power surges, it would try to die, but then idle itself back up. When you go to drive it, sometimes it would run fine after a few minutes. But each time it is shut off and you go back to start it, it does the same thing over again. Someone please help!!

Codes are 33, 34, and 45.

I agree with CutlassOlds88, the code 33 and 34 both refer to the MAF sensor on your vehicle (or MAP sensor for vehicles not equipped with a MAF). When both these codes are shown at the same time, it indicates a shorted MAF/MAP sensor. The code 45 is rich exhaust, caused by the bad MAP/MAF sensor.

Well I ended up changing the MAP sensor. Still had the same problem. So my husband was messing around and found out that FWD does have both a Map sensor and an air flow sensor. Replaced it and the car hasnt stalled since, and the engine light went off.
